HuggingChat is Hugging Face's free, open-source chat interface, relaunched in late 2025 as 'HuggingChat Omni' with a smart router that auto-picks the best of 115+ open models from providers like Groq, Cerebras, and Together. It's genuinely free (metered by Hugging Face inference credits, with a PRO plan at ~$9/mo for much more), needs no credit card, and the whole chat-ui is open-source and self-hostable with your own keys. It only serves open models -- no first-party GPT, Claude, or Gemini -- so it's best for developers and privacy-minded users. It was briefly shut down in mid-2025, a reminder that continuity isn't guaranteed.

Poe, built by Quora, is an aggregator that puts ChatGPT, Claude, Gemini, Llama, Mistral, image and video models, and millions of community bots behind a single subscription. Plans run from a $5/mo entry tier up to $19.99/mo and a $249.99/mo power tier, all metered by a per-message 'points' system that can be confusing to budget. An official, OpenAI- and Anthropic-compatible API draws from the same points, and a creator platform lets you build and share custom bots. It's the best one-stop shop if you want every model on one bill, but it's a reseller, not a model maker.
